The Angel stood amongst hell's demons,
Waiting to be judged.
A stench was strong of ashes and blood.
Alone the Angel swayed.
An evil creature spoke to him,
"walk this way."
The Angels wings were black and crisping,
From the scorching flames and the harsh whispering.
The Angels feet crushed skulls and bones,
Lining a path to the Devils throne.
The Angels body quaked with fear,
The demons and the Devil evilly cheered.
Satan said to this fallen Angel
"I would destroy you, but I am unable.
You are here to be judged."
"A fallen Angel I may be,
But I still have my dignity."
The Angel replied.
"To heaven your access was denied,
Here you are exposed, unable to hide.
What dignity to you have?"
"None that you would understand,
I have a heart therefore I can love"
"You left your heart with your halo,
Do not speak of love only of sorrow."
The Angel began to sob.
Nothing he could do.
"Without that love, I am as worthless as you."
This fallen Angel brave as he was,
Broke down into flowing sobs.
The fallen Angel had hit the ground.
To hell he would stay, eternally bound.
